Semaglutide is a GLP-1 receptor agonist — a prescription medication that reduces appetite, slows gastric emptying, and quiets food noise by activating hunger-regulating receptors in the brain. Clinical trials (STEP) showed average total body weight loss of approximately 15% at the highest dose.

- What is the difference between Ozempic and Wegovy in Birmingham?
- Both contain semaglutide. Ozempic is FDA-approved for type 2 diabetes. Wegovy is FDA-approved specifically for chronic weight management. A provider determines which is appropriate for your situation.
